技术文摘
用Deno制作首个项目
用Deno制作首个项目
在当今的软件开发领域,Deno以其独特的优势吸引着众多开发者。现在,就让我们一起踏上用Deno制作首个项目的奇妙之旅。
要开启Deno项目之旅,得先安装Deno。Deno的安装过程十分简便,无论是在Windows、Mac还是Linux系统上,都有相应清晰的官方文档指引。安装完成后,我们就可以正式迈出项目创建的第一步。
假设我们要制作一个简单的命令行工具,用于计算两个数字的和。创建一个新的文件夹作为项目目录,这将是我们项目的“家”。接着,在这个目录里创建一个主脚本文件,比如命名为main.ts。
在main.ts文件中,我们先引入必要的模块。Deno拥有丰富的内置模块和第三方模块生态。对于我们这个简单的计算工具,利用基本的输入输出模块即可。我们可以通过Deno提供的标准输入功能,获取用户在命令行输入的两个数字。
使用Deno.readTextFileSync函数来读取命令行参数。然后,将接收到的字符串参数转化为数字类型,这一步很关键,因为只有数字类型才能进行加法运算。接下来,实现核心的计算功能,将两个数字相加。最后,通过Deno.stdout.writeSync函数把计算结果输出到命令行界面,让用户看到计算的成果。
完成代码编写后,如何运行我们的项目呢?在项目目录的命令行中,输入deno run main.ts命令,就能启动我们的程序。如果一切顺利,你输入的两个数字之和将会清晰地显示在屏幕上。
通过这个简单的首个项目,我们体验到了Deno的便捷与高效。它无需复杂的配置文件,就能快速搭建起一个可用的项目。Deno的安全机制也让开发者放心,它默认限制程序对系统资源的访问,避免了许多潜在的安全风险。随着对Deno的深入学习,我们可以基于它开发出功能更为强大、复杂的项目,无论是Web应用、后端服务,还是各类实用的工具,Deno都能为我们提供有力的支持。
- JavaScript与WebSocket构建高效实时交易系统
- Highcharts中用三角函数图展示数据的方法
- Vue和Vue-Router动态路由的创建方法
- ECharts 中利用地理坐标系展示地图数据的方法
- 利用WebSocket与JavaScript构建在线语音识别系统的方法
- Uniapp 中动态添加与删除路由的方法
- Highcharts中使用瀑布图展示数据的方法
- JavaScript 与 WebSocket 构建高效实时数据备份系统
- Highcharts中用时间轴展示数据变化的方法
- ECharts数据可视化:让数据展示更生动的方法
- 用JavaScript和WebSocket构建实时聊天室的方法
- ECharts树图:数据层级结构展示方法
- ECharts热力图展示数据密度分布的方法
- uniapp实现页面后退功能的方法
- WebSocket和JavaScript:实时交通路况查询的关键技术